Cambridge House came out on top yesterday afternoon by 17 – 13 against Regent House at Ballymena RFC in the final re-fixed Danske Bank Schools Cup match of Round 3.

Cambridge House will now host Royal School Armagh in Round 4 with the match to be played on or before Saturday 3rd February.

The full draw for the Danske Bank Schools Cup Round 4 is shown below.

Schools Cup Fourth Round Draw

Enniskillen Royal Grammar SchoolvBallymena Academy
Omagh Academy/Bangor GrammarvRainey Endowed
Royal School DungannonvWallace High School
Campbell CollegevDalriada
Cambridge HousevRoyal School Armagh
Sullivan UppervDown High School
Royal Belfast Academical InstitutionvBallyclare High School
Coleraine GrammarvMethodist College

Matches to be played on or before Saturday 3rd February
Bangor Grammar v Omagh Academy Replay on Saturday 27th January
